518-831-8000 sales@utechproducts.com

Diclazuril, Sheep, Polyclonal Antibody, Abnova, Sheep polyclonal antibody raised against Diclazuril, Each

2,085.60

Details

Sheep polyclonal antibody raised against Diclazuril.

Additional Information

SKU 10267548
UOM Each
UNSPSC 12352203
Manufacturer Part Number PAB8258